Choosing an SEO Agency: A Comprehensive Guide

The Importance of Choosing the Right SEO Company

Selecting the right SEO agency is a critical decision that can significantly impact your online visibility and business growth. However, choosing the wrong agency can lead to wasted resources, missed opportunities, and even damage to your website's reputation. This guide will walk you through the essential factors to consider when selecting an SEO company, ensuring you make an informed decision.  

Understanding Your Needs

Before you start evaluating SEO agencies, it's crucial to have a clear understanding of your own needs and goals. This involves several key steps:  

Set Clear SEO Goals: Begin by defining what you want to achieve with SEO. Are you looking to increase website traffic, improve keyword rankings, generate more leads, or enhance brand visibility? Linking your SEO goals to your overall business objectives ensures that your SEO efforts are aligned with your company's mission.  

Assess Your Current SEO Situation: It’s important to know where you stand in terms of SEO. Conduct a website audit to understand your website's strengths and weaknesses. This assessment will help you pinpoint areas that require the most attention. What are your current challenges? Do you have any existing penalties on your site?  

Identify Your Key Requirements: What are your business's specific needs? Do you need local SEO, e-commerce SEO, or technical SEO? Understanding these specific needs will allow you to filter out agencies that are not the right fit.  

Evaluating Potential SEO Agencies

Once you understand your needs, you can start evaluating potential SEO agencies. Here’s what to consider:  

Check Their Expertise and Experience: What specific areas of SEO do they specialize in? Do they have proven experience in your industry or with similar businesses? Look for agencies that have a diverse team with expertise in various SEO disciplines, such as technical SEO, content creation, and link building.

Analyze Their Portfolio and Case Studies: Do they have a track record of success? Examine their past projects and client results. Look for case studies that demonstrate how they've helped other businesses achieve their SEO goals. Don’t hesitate to request more information on how they handled a particular project.  

Look into Their SEO Strategies and Methodologies: What is their approach to SEO? Do they use white-hat techniques that align with Google's guidelines? Ensure the agency you choose does not engage in black-hat tactics that could harm your website's reputation. You should also ask for their overall SEO philosophy, to make sure it aligns with your business goals.  

Read Client Testimonials and Reviews: What do past clients say about them? Checking reviews can help you understand the agency's strengths and weaknesses. Look for consistent patterns in the feedback that clients have provided.  

Assess Transparency and Communication: How do they communicate their plans and results? A good agency will be transparent about its strategies and will provide regular reports on your SEO progress. Look for agencies that prioritize clear communication, and are happy to explain complex issues in a simple manner.  

Consider Your Budget and Pricing Models: What are your budget constraints, and what pricing model best suits your needs? SEO pricing models can vary, so it’s important to understand the different options (e.g., hourly rates, project-based fees, monthly retainers) and choose a model that aligns with your financial resources.  

Common Mistakes to Avoid When Hiring an SEO Company

Choosing the wrong SEO agency can be costly, so avoid these common pitfalls:  

Choosing a Cheap Agency: While budget is important, choosing the cheapest option can often result in poor quality work, and may do more harm than good to your site. Investing in a high-quality agency can provide better ROI in the long run.  

Falling for Unrealistic Promises: Be wary of agencies that guarantee top rankings or quick results. SEO is a long-term strategy, and any agency promising immediate success is not being truthful.  

Ignoring the Need for Ongoing Maintenance and Support: SEO is not a one-time project. Ensure the agency you choose provides ongoing maintenance, support, and regular optimization to adapt to changing search algorithms and market trends.

Not Conducting Thorough Research: Failing to do your due diligence can result in choosing the wrong agency. Always vet potential SEO partners carefully and ask the right questions.  

Hiring an Agency that uses Black-Hat Tactics: Black-hat SEO techniques can lead to serious penalties from search engines. Ensure you're working with an agency that uses ethical SEO practices.  

Prioritizing Quantity over Quality: Don't be fooled by agencies that focus on quantity over quality, in terms of links, and content. A focus on high-quality content and links is always a better approach.  

Not Considering an Agency's Communication Plan and Transparency: A lack of communication can lead to misunderstandings and disappointment. Make sure that the agency has a clearly defined plan for keeping you updated, as well as presenting data in a way you can understand.  

Understanding Key Performance Indicators (KPIs)

Understanding the KPIs of your campaign is essential for assessing the success of your SEO efforts. Here are some key metrics to track:  

Important SEO Metrics to Track: Dive deep into organic traffic, keyword rankings, backlinks, organic conversions, branded vs. non-branded traffic, search visibility, click-through rate (CTR), Google Business Profile metrics, SEO ROI, and core web vitals. Make sure that the agency you choose is able to not only track these metrics, but explain what they mean, and how they relate to your business goals.  

Leading vs. Lagging Indicators: Understand the difference between leading and lagging indicators. Leading indicators are predictive measures (such as website speed) that help you foresee future outcomes, and lagging indicators are measures that show your past performance (such as organic traffic). Both are important to measure.

How to Track these Metrics: Ensure that the agency has tools and processes in place to monitor these metrics effectively and regularly. They should also be able to explain how they use these tools.

How to Analyze and Use Data to Make Informed Decisions: Make sure that the agency is able to analyze these metrics, and that they also use this data to make informed decisions to guide strategy. Don’t just rely on surface-level reporting.  

How to Best Report on KPIs to Clients: The agency should have a process in place for reporting KPIs to clients, ideally with visual data presentations. They should be able to use data storytelling to clearly illustrate progress and show where improvements can be made.  

Types of SEO Agencies

Not all SEO agencies are created equal. Here are some distinctions to consider:  

SEO Agencies vs. SEO Content Agencies: SEO agencies may focus more on technical optimization and link building, while SEO content agencies focus primarily on creating high-quality content that ranks. Depending on your needs, you may need one more than the other, or both.  

Industry-Specific vs. Industry-Agnostic Agencies: Some agencies specialize in particular industries, and may understand their niches better than others. If you’re in a niche industry, then a specific agency may be more useful than a general one.  

Agencies With CMS Expertise: The importance of CMS familiarity for efficient implementation can vary, but for some businesses, it can be critical for effective implementation.  

Matching the Agency to Your Business

The type of SEO agency you need can depend on your type and size of business:  

SEO Agencies for Fortune 500 Companies vs. SMBs: Large corporations have different needs and constraints than small to medium-sized businesses. A big agency may not be a great fit for a small business, and vice versa.  

Choosing the Right Agency Based on Your Own SEO Knowledge: If you have no knowledge of SEO, then you may want an agency that's willing to provide education and explanations every step of the way. Alternatively, if you have a strong understanding of SEO, then you might need an agency that's more focused on strategy, and implementation.  

Conclusion

Choosing the right SEO agency is crucial for your business's success. By understanding your needs, evaluating potential agencies carefully, avoiding common mistakes, and tracking the right KPIs, you can make an informed decision and achieve your SEO goals. Remember, selecting the right partner can significantly impact your online visibility and long-term growth.